 N-(2H3)Methylethanamine Biological Activity

Description N-Methylethanamine-d3 is the deuterium labeled N-Methylethanamine[1].
Related Catalog
In Vitro Stable heavy isotopes of hydrogen, carbon, and other elements have been incorporated into drug molecules, largely as tracers for quantitation during the drug development process. Deuteration has gained attention because of its potential to affect the pharmacokinetic and metabolic profiles of drugs[1].

 Chemical & Physical Properties

Density 0.7±0.1 g/cm3
Boiling Point 36.7±3.0 °C at 760 mmHg
Molecular Formula C3H6D3N
Molecular Weight 62.129
Flash Point -37.5±8.8 °C
Exact Mass 62.092331
PSA 12.03000
LogP 0.10
Vapour Pressure 488.2±0.1 mmHg at 25°C
Index of Refraction 1.368
